dc.description.abstractThe study aims to examine the extent to which power relations in the Nile River Basin have developed over the past decades with special attention to the two Nile riparian nations, Egypt and Ethiopia. By applying hydro-hegemony as a theoretical framework, the thesis analyzes Ethiopia’s counter-hegemonic tactics and strategies to challenge unequal hydro-configurations under the Egyptian dominance. A variety of factors that have entailed power asymmetry in the Nile River Basin will be addressed through the evaluation of a series of transboundary water agreements from the 1990s to the present. The case of the Grand Ethiopian Renaissance Dam (GERD) will be evaluated to elaborate the strategies of Ethiopian counter-hegemony strategies that will enable Ethiopia to reallocate the Nile water resources for the upstream and downstream countries. The study appraises diverse impacts of the GERD and discusses whether the dam will culminate ensuing conflicts or cooperation.-
